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Eligible patients had to be between 18 and 40 years of age
- have generalized neck pain for more than 3 months.
- with symptoms provoked by neck postures, movements, or palpation
Exclusion
- Subjects' exclusion criteria included specific neck pain due to trauma, disc protrusion, whiplash, congenital deformity of the spine, spinal stenosis, neoplasm, inflammatory or rheumatic disease. Furthermore, subjects were excluded if they had a history of spine surgery and any objective findings consistent with neurological conditions and vascular disorders.
